How much do part time environmental compliance man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time environmental compliance manager in the United States is $93,255.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$72,000.00 and $113,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Part Time Environmental Compliance Manager vs Environmental Specialist?

AspectPart Time Environmental Compliance ManagerEnvironmental Specialist
CertificationsEnvironmental certifications (e.g., CEC, CEM)Environmental certifications often preferred
Work EnvironmentOffice and field, part-time hoursFieldwork and office tasks, full-time or part-time
Employer & IndustryManufacturing, construction, energy sectorsEnvironmental consulting, government agencies, industry
Primary FocusEnsuring compliance with environmental laws and regulationsMonitoring, data collection, environmental assessments

The Part Time Environmental Compliance Manager primarily oversees regulatory adherence and manages compliance programs, often in a managerial capacity. In contrast, an Environmental Specialist focuses on environmental monitoring, data collection, and assessments. Both roles may require similar certifications and work in related industries, but the Compliance Manager has a broader oversight role, often with managerial responsibilities, while the Specialist concentrates on technical environmental tasks.

Job description

Description:

This is a 10 month (August - May), full-time and a 2 month (June & July), part-time administrative appointment reporting to the department chairperson of the chemistry program.


Candidates will have a bachelor’s degree in a scientific field with preference towards chemistry, biology, biochemistry, environmental safety or industrial hygiene. Preference will be given to candidates with at least two years’ experience in the environmental safety field. Upon hire, candidates are required to maintain appropriate certified training in hazardous materials training in compliance governmental regulations. Strong organizational skills and attention to detail are needed for success in this position.


The successful candidate will demonstrate an ability to effectively perform the following functions 1) Dispose of hazardous waste in compliance with EPA regulations. 2) Actively manage the Vermeer Science Center stockroom, including student workers and inventory. 3) Supervise the laboratory preparation in support of natural science faculty. 4) Facilitate a safe laboratory environment through documentation of procedures, chemical handling, and training of students. 5) Procurement of chemicals, supplies, and equipment. 6) Manage the functionality of the equipment in collaboration with departments including balances, microscopes, safety equipment, etc. 7) Manage stockroom budget. 8) Other functions as needed in collaboration with biology, chemistry, engineering, physics, and other STEM programs as needed.
